1: 2 Samuel 3:7


Keywords: AJAH,CONCUBINAGE,CONSPIRACY,RIZPAH


Description: 2 Samuel 3:7


NET Translation: Now Saul had a concubine named RIZPAH daughter of Aiah. Ish Bosheth said to Abner, “Why did you sleep with my father’s concubine?”


DARBY Translation: And Saul had a concubine whose name was RIZPAH, the daughter of Aiah. And [Ishbosheth] said to Abner, Why hast thou gone in to my father's concubine?


KJV Translation: And Saul had a concubine, whose name [was] RIZPAH, the daughter of Aiah: and [Ishbosheth] said to Abner, Wherefore hast thou gone in unto my father's concubine?

2: 2 Samuel 21:8


Keywords: ADRIEL,AJAH,ARMONI,BARZILLAI,MEHOLATHITE,MEPHIBOSHETH,RIZPAH


Description: 2 Samuel 21:8


NET Translation: So the king took Armoni and Mephibosheth, the two sons of Aiah’s daughter RIZPAH whom she had born to Saul, and the five sons of Saul’s daughter Merab whom she had born to Adriel the son of Barzillai the Meholathite.


DARBY Translation: And the king took the two sons of RIZPAH the daughter of Aiah, whom she had borne to Saul, Armoni and Mephibosheth; and the five sons of [the sister of]D2029 Michal the daughter of Saul, whom she had borne to Adriel the son of Barzillai the Meholathite;


KJV Translation: But the king took the two sons of RIZPAH the daughter of Aiah, whom she bare unto Saul, Armoni and Mephibosheth; and the five sons of MichalK1694the daughter of Saul, whom she brought up for AdrielK1695the son of Barzillai the Meholathite:

3: 2 Samuel 21:10


Keywords: PARENTS


Description: 2 Samuel 21:10


NET Translation: RIZPAH the daughter of Aiah took sackcloth and spread it out for herself on a rock. From the beginning of the harvest until the rain fell on them, she did not allow the birds of the air to feed on them by day, nor the wild animals by night.


DARBY Translation: Then RIZPAH the daughter of Aiah took sackcloth, and spread it for her upon the rock, from the beginning of harvest until water poured on them out of the heavens, and suffered neither the fowl of the heavens to rest on them by day, nor the beasts of the field by night.


KJV Translation: And RIZPAH the daughter of Aiah took sackcloth, and spread it for her upon the rock, from the beginning of harvest until water dropped upon them out of heaven, and suffered neither the birds of the air to rest on them by day, nor the beasts of the field by night.
